GCISD progresses on fiber-optic system

In June the city of Grapevine and Grapevine-Colleyville ISD signed an agreement to partner together to enhance Internet and local network connectivity for both entities by investing in a more than $5 million fiber-optic cable system.

Construction on the 57-mile system will be done in phases over the next five years.

The district and the city of Grapevine continue to make progress on the fiber-optic system, according to GCISD’s Senior Systems Engineer Ron Stockenberg.

The city and district are spending January working together to map pathways and rights of way. Stockenberg said Colleyville is working on an agreement to allow the city of Grapevine to lay fiber within Colleyville city limits to GCISD’s Colleyville campuses.
